I'll break mine down into four categories; 1st, 2nd and 3rd tier plus those I won't be buying again.
1st Tier J.M. Fraser's - Just got this (Thanks, Smedley!!) and it's already my absolute favorite. Pleasant lemony scent and very lubricating. Plus it comes in a huge 450ml tub (about twice what you get from Taylor's).
C&E Almond and Taylor's Almond - both perform very well (too bad about the scents; just don't care for either)
2nd Tier Taylor's Lavender and GFT Rose - love the scent of both and I get awesome shaves from these. Just not quite on a par with Tier 1.
3rd Tier Taylor's St. James and Mr. Taylor
T&H Grafton and 1805
Salter Citrus
Proraso Green
All are fine, just not as good as the others.
Will never buy again Taylor's Avocado. Too bad because it does what shaving cream is supposed to do and it does it very well. I just don't care for the scent. Sickeningly sweet...to my nose anyway. If you like the scent, buy some as it's a very good cream.
GFT Coconut. Shaves ok, but has absolutely NO scent! NONE! Can't understand the RAVES I've read about the scent of this one. Did I mention that it has no scent?
GFT Violet. Again, shave is fine, but it smells like wet cardboard.
Musgo Real. Love the scent, but my face doesn't get along with this one at all.

So can anyone describe their experience with the Vulfix Lavender and Sandalwood??
Raf
On the Vulfix Lavendar...
Bluish purple color, but lathers up white (though I keep my "white" bristle away from it from paranoia).
Medium density cream (thicker than Salter's)
Lathers easily with good volume
Applies in a nice, thick, opaque layer with good cushion
Only Lavendar that I own, so nothing to compare to for scent. Smells minty without too much floral.
Contains glycerin & aloe vera, but also parabens
